The Pearson Test of English (PTE) has become a popular choice for non-native English speakers seeking to fulfill language proficiency requirements for various visa applications. Unlike other standardized tests, the PTE provides a computer-based evaluation that determines speaking, writing, reading, and listening abilities, making it a convenient alternative for many. PTE for Visa Applications: Importance and Requirements
Numerous countries, including Australia, Canada, the UK, and New Zealand, require proof of English language efficiency as part of the visa application procedure. The PTE certificate acts as a legitimate proof of this efficiency.

Advantages of PTE for Visa Purposes
Quick Results: Unlike other English efficiency tests that can take weeks to process, the PTE normally offers outcomes within 48 hours, aiding in quicker visa processing.
Versatile Scheduling: Test-takers have the flexibility to select from a variety of test dates and places, making it hassle-free for candidates worldwide.
Comprehensive Assessment: The PTE evaluates all four parts of language abilities, guaranteeing that prospects meet the required proficiency levels in speaking, writing, reading, and listening.
International Acceptance: The PTE is acknowledged by thousands of institutions worldwide, boosting its credibility and making it a flexible choice for candidates.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. What is a PTE rating valid for?
A PTE score is usually legitimate for two years from the date of the test. After this period, test-takers should retake the examination to satisfy requirements for visa applications or instructional purposes.
2. How is the PTE scored?
The PTE utilizes an automated scoring system that evaluates different language efficiency aspects. Each section is scored out of 90, with a total score representing general English efficiency.
3. Can I choose which scores to send to universities or immigration authorities?
Yes, PTE enables you to select which institutions or companies get your ratings. You can send your scores to approximately 7 organizations complimentary of charge.
4. What occurs if I do not attain the necessary score?
If you do not attain the necessary score for your visa application, you can retake the test as many times as you require. It is suggested to evaluate your performance on the previous attempt to identify areas needing improvement.
5. Is there an age limitation for taking the PTE?
There is no age limit for taking the PTE; however, candidates are normally advised to be a minimum of 16 years old.
